Job Title: Project Manager

Company Description:

TeDan Surgical Innovations (TSI) is a leading manufacturer of specialty surgical products for spine, neuro, thoracic, and orthopedic surgeries. With a strong focus on innovation and quality, TSI has established itself as a trusted partner for medical professionals.


Job Summary:

The Project Manager will oversee and manage projects within the business, ensuring timely completion, budget adherence, and high-quality standards. The ideal candidate will have a strong background in project management, a deep understanding of the medical device industry, and excellent communication skills.


Duties/Essential Job Functions:

  • Develop comprehensive project plans, including scope, schedule, budget, and resource allocation.
  • Define project objectives, deliverables, and key performance indicators (KPIs).
  • Coordinate cross-functional teams to ensure successful project execution.
  • Manage project timelines, ensuring that milestones and deadlines are met.
  • Monitor and control project budgets, ensuring cost-effective use of resources.
  • Ensure all project activities comply with internal operating procedures, relevant regulatory standards (e.g., FDA, ISO), and customer requirements.
  • Serve as a point of contact for external customers.
  • Provide regular updates and status reports to Engineering Management and other key stakeholders.
  • Identify potential project risks (such as resource constraints, budget overruns, timeline delays, etc.) and develop mitigation strategies.
  • Address and resolve issues that may arise during the project lifecycle.
  • Evaluate project outcomes and implement improvements to enhance future project performance.
  • Foster a culture of continuous learning and best practices within the team.
  • Awareness of General TSI Quality Management System (QMS), Good Documentation Practices (GDP), Good Manufacturing Practices (GMP), and Complaint Handling through annual TSI Training


Knowledge/Skills:

  • Strong understanding of medical device development processes, regulatory requirements, and industry standards.
  • Proven track record of successful projects.
  • Exceptional verbal and written communication skills, with the ability to effectively engage with diverse internal and external stakeholders.
  • Good task and time management skills with the ability to manage multiple projects simultaneously.
  • Proven ability to identify and resolve complex issues and challenges.
  • Ability to use Microsoft Office (Word, PowerPoint, & Excel).
  • Excellent project management, organizational, and leadership skills. Proficiency in project management software (e.g., MS Project)


Required Minimum Education/Experience:

  • Bachelor's degree in business, marketing, life science, or engineering (science, medical technology, biomedical engineering) or similar areas.
  • Advanced degrees or certifications (e.g., PMP, Six Sigma) are a plus.
  • 3+ years professional experience in medical device industry.
  • 2+ years experience in Project Management.


Physical Requirements:

  • Occasionally requires travel (10-15%)
  • Occasionally requires attending corporate functions
  • Business casual attire
  • Lift up to 25lbs
